2017 Husqvarna 701 Supermoto, 2017 Husqvarna® 701 Supermoto THE ESSENCE OF RIDING With close to 70 hp, advanced electronics and a state-of-the-art chassis, the 145 kg 701 Supermoto captures the thrill of the race track and brings the pure riding essence of Supermoto to the street. Features may include: Engine The single overhead cam, liquid cooled, single cylinder engine features the latest in design and electronic technology. An outstanding maximum power output of 49 kW (67 hp) at 7,000 rpm and torque of 67 Nm at 6,500 rpm leave the rider in no doubt of the performance packed inside this lightweight unit Cylinder head The compact design of the single overhead cam cylinder head features 40 mm steel intake valves weighing just 48 g thanks to their hollow stem design, and 34 mm exhaust valves weighing 46.5 g. Ignition is via a double spark plug layout, each of which has an individual ignition timing control for optimal fuel combustion in the large bore combustion chamber. Refined engine behaviour and optimum power delivery are the results. Ride-by-wire throttle The Keihin electronic fuel injection system features a 46 mm throttle body with no mechanical linkage to the throttle grip. As the rider twists the throttle open or closed, the throttle valve is electronically controlled by the engine management system (EMS). The EMS continuously compares engine parameters with data from sensors, and adjusts the throttle valve accordingly, resulting in perfect power delivery and throttle response. Gearbox A lightweight 6 speed gearbox with smooth and precise shifting gives riders perfect control and confidence even in extreme conditions. Wheels Black anodised Giant tubeless spoked wheels are lightweight and strong. The 17" wheels are shod with Continental ContiAttack Supermoto 120/70 and 160/60 tyres front and rear respectively for extraordinarily light handling and exceptional control at all lean angles. Engine maps Three engine maps are available and can be selected via a switch under the seat. Riders can choose between "Standard", "Soft" and "Advanced" engine setups according to riding conditions. Brakes Amazing stopping power and control are available at the rider's demand thanks to the radially mounted 4 piston Brembo calliper and floating disc at the front, and the single piston calliper, floating disc at the rear (320 and 240 mm diameters respectively). The latest ABS technology from Bosch with Supermoto mode guarantees maximum safety and total confidence. Slipper clutch The APTC (Adler Power Torque Clutch) from Adler allows for greater speeds going into and coming out of corners by maximising rear wheel grip under hard acceleration as well as preventing rear wheel instability and hopping when braking hard into the apex of a turn. The rider thus enjoys maximum control and perfect down-shifting.

2007 Kawasaki KLR650, Clean KLR with Mods, Alum handlebars, wide foot pegs, tall windsheild, full rack system with soft bags, tank bag - Legendary comfort and versatility wherever your adventures take you. The KLR650 is one of those rare motorcycles with the ability to play just about any role its rider chooses. The KLR?s roomy ergonomics, bump swallowing suspension, large fuel capacity and efficient engine provide riders with amazing range and the versatility to travel far beyond city streets or highways. Equipped with optional Kawasaki accessories, the KLR650 might just be the ultimate world traveler. Power for the KLR650 comes from a strong, dual overhead cam, four-valve, liquid-cooled, single cylinder, 651cc four-stroke engine. The engine provides a wide range of power equally suitable for negotiating low-speed trails and cruising at a more brisk highway pace. An engine crankshaft counterbalancer and electric starter provide additional rider comfort and convenience. The frame for the KLR650 is made of round-section high-tensile steel, and a detachable rear subframe simplifies maintenance by providing easier access to the airbox, carburetor and rear shock. Adjustable, long-travel suspension provides a plush ride on both pavement and off-road. A U.S. Forest Service-approved spark arrestor provides access to any road open to licensed vehicles, while a sturdy engine guard protects the engine from loose rocks and gravel. With an optional Kawasaki tank bag and soft luggage on the large standard rear rack, KLR650 owners can tote enough gear for an extended trip to any remote location.

2015 Triumph Tiger 800 XCx, 2015 Triumph Tiger 800 XCX The spirit of adventure isn t just alive. It s built into every single component of the new XCx Fully equipped for long adventures with technology that adds improved handling and opens up whole new horizons, this is the Tiger taken to a different level. Selecting between three different Riding Modes, ROAD, OFF-ROAD and programmable RIDER MODE, you can configure your preferred throttle map, ABS and Triumph Traction Control, for a completely tailored and thrilling adventure ride. The dedicated Trip Computer and the Cruise Control enable you to amass miles with complete confidence. The off-road soul of the bike is emphasized by the adventure pack including hand guards, aluminium sump guard, centre stand, additional power socket and engine protection bars. Features May Include: ADVANCED ABS The XCx adds a more advanced ABS system that can be changed between ROAD, OFF-ROAD, and OFF. When the Off-Road mode is selected, the ABS is disabled to the rear wheel and the system also allows a level of front wheel slip. This provides the rider with a level of electronic intervention under braking whilst optimizing their off road enjoyment. TRACTION CONTROL The higher specification XCx has traction control that can be configured to Road, Off-Road, or Off settings. In the Off-Road mode, the traction control system allows increased rear wheel slip compared to the Road mode. Riders can configure their traction control preferences in conjunction with the 3 Rider Mode settings. THROTTLE MAPS With a choice of 4 different throttle maps, riders can select the optimum setting to meet both riding and weather conditions. The throttle maps can easily be changed between Rain, Road, Sport, or Off-Road via the switch cube to provide greater levels of control to meet changing conditions. 3 RIDING MODES On the XCx, riders can very simply configure the bike to the terrain with the choice of 3 Rider Modes. This automatically configures the ABS, Traction Control, and Throttle Maps to best tackle the route ahead. With a choice of ROAD, OFF-ROAD, or PROGRAMMABLE RIDER MODE, all of the electronic safety devices are optimized for the conditions. The PROGRAMMABLE RIDER MODE is fully configurable and allows the rider to select their chosen settings for ABS, Traction Control, and a choice of 4 x Throttle Maps independently. TRIPLE ENGINE The new Tiger features a liquid-cooled, 800cc in-line-three cylinder engine, delivering 95PS and 79Nm of torque for power across the entire rev range and the distinctive Triumph triple sound and character. FUEL EFFICIENCY The Tiger XCx has a 17% improvement in fuel efficiency on the EU mixed cycle which means that fuel economy improves from 55mpg to 65 mpg versus the outgoing Tiger giving a potential range of 272 miles.
